by andy
Most of the information is in the answers given but after reading all of them it is
still a little confusing because some of the answers are wrong.

If you want larger injectors you will be looking for late 90's Mazda Millenia S model
injectors. It has a 2.3l supercharged motor.
Stock KL injectors (2.5L) are 220 cc ZE or DE
Stock K8 injectors (1.8L) are 180 cc
Stock KJ injectors (2.3L) are 280 cc
The injectors are a direct drop into your ZE fuel rails. But you will have to
remove them from the KJ rail and swap them with your KL rail.
Also The car will run like crap without a way to adjust the fuel pressure. So an FPR
would be a good addition also.
This has been tried before without any real benefits unless your going FI in the near future.
